//! Bridge that lets a local engine subscribe to a remote ReifyDB instance and forward incoming change payloads into
//! a local channel or sink. Wraps the gRPC client, handles authentication, and proxies raw RBCF payloads through a
//! conversion callback so the caller controls how remote events are typed.
//!
//! This is the only place in the workspace where external wire-format payloads are turned into events the local
//! engine consumes; doing the conversion anywhere else would couple unrelated subsystems to the gRPC client and
//! `wire-format` decoders.
